Hello,

I have Netbackup master server on Solaris. Recently, I updated it to 7.6.1.1.

Today, I've installed additional client software(for Linux systems)  on master server(ver 7.6.1) and now I've looking for solution how to update them to 7.6.1.1 without reinstalling complete pack NB_CLT_7.6.1.1. And, especially, without restarting NBU daemons on master server(as NB_CLT pack requiring).

You can't patch while deamons are running - Sorry. You need to run NB_update.install again with the -p option to override the version check.

E.g.:

 ./NB_update.install -p

then select NB_CLT_7.6.1.1

You will get a message about exactly the issue you are having:

Unless you are installing a new platform
type for a previously installed package,
it is strongly recommended that this package,
be uninstalled before reinstalling.

Then procees to update previous installed clients.

Use Netbackup Live Update policy to upgrade your all clients to master server version,without logging to client server and without restart of netbackup master server daemons.
